3 benefits of Self-Care in Mental Health

Improved Emotional Well-being: Engaging in regular self-care practices can have a profound impact on your emotional well-being. Taking time to focus on your needs, whether it's through relaxation techniques, engaging in hobbies, or seeking support, can help reduce stress, anxiety, and depression. Self-care allows you to recharge and replenish your emotional reserves, leading to a greater sense of calm, happiness, and overall emotional balance.

Enhanced Stress Management: Self-care is a powerful tool for managing and reducing stress. When you prioritize self-care, you create a buffer against the pressures and demands of daily life. Engaging in stress-reducing activities such as exercise, meditation, or spending time in nature can help regulate your stress response, lower cortisol levels, and promote a sense of relaxation. By incorporating self-care into your routine, you build resilience and develop effective coping mechanisms to navigate stressors more effectively.

Increased Self-Compassion and Self-Acceptance: Self-care nurtures self-compassion and self-acceptance, fostering a positive relationship with yourself. Engaging in activities that promote self-care sends a powerful message that you value and prioritize your well-being. By practicing self-compassion and treating yourself with kindness and understanding, you cultivate a sense of self-worth and learn to accept yourself as you are. This, in turn, can enhance self-esteem, self-confidence, and overall self-acceptance.
